Don't just lather 1 times a day

Many people have misconceptions, smeared sunscreen will help protect your skin all day. Sunscreen should be reapplied after two hours, after exercise or when participating in water-related activities. Best, check the manufacturer's manual to know how often need reapplied sunscreen.=
